We may also collect information via technology including cookies about you from our websites when you visit which is added to your details if we have collected them and which is used in conjunction with the other information about you, including for enhancing your experience.

A cookie is a small piece of computer code which remains on your computer and contains information which helps us identify your browser and previous information viewed in relation to our service. When you visit our websites the cookie records certain details including the date, time and advertising content of that site. The information we collect in this way may include your Internet service provider’s address, date and time of your visit, Pages accessed and type of browser used.

If you do not want us to use cookies then you can easily stop them, or be notified when they are being used, by adopting the appropriate settings on your browser. If you do not allow cookies to be used, some or all of our website might not be accessible to you.
